the lift isn't intended for 2nd gens. even if it did fit the suspension geometry is different. if i'm not mistaken the 4th gens have a multi link setup in the rear while 2nd gens have coils up front and leaf springs in the rear.

Different axles, different control arms, different track bars, different pitman arms, different coils, different leaf springs, that's even if the 4th gen kit you have is for leaf sprung trucks. Later model 4th gens are 4 linked in the front and rear.

So.....No.

As said you need the correct kit. The suspension is to different.

Some info everyone else may find interesting to do with 4g suspension.

4g 1500 09-15
Front Suspension - IFS
Rear Suspension 4 Link Coils

4g 2500 10-13
Front Suspension - Solid Axle with radius arms
Rear Suspension - Rear Leafs

4g 2500 14-15
Front Suspension - Solid Axle with radius arms
Rear Suspension - 4 Link Coils

4g 3500 10-15
Front Suspension - Solid Axle with radius arms
Rear Suspension - Rear Leafs
